autotest: Remove network_WiFi_Netperf and derivative tests

Recent investigation into our testing methodology reveals that
performance tests in regular WiFi cells are overly sensitive to
little physical configuration differences like the relative positions of
the antenna and DUT.  This can cause dramatic differences in measured
throughput that invalidates negative results.  In addition, high
throughput could indicate that we're merely using a higher symbol rate
rather than taking advantage of frame aggregation.
